Aims and Scope

The Research Probe (TRP) is a proceedings journal of institutional conferences and research competitions. It focuses on two broad themes: social sciences and humanities; and sciences and technology. This journal provides a platform for academic researchers and industry practitioners from various fields in the dissemination of their research works. It promotes a wider horizon for researchers through open-access paradigm.

TRP publishes articles employing any of the various research methods and strategies. It accepts any specific topic within these broad subjects. It also encourages interdisciplinary articles that broadly discuss key topics relevant to the core scope of the journal.

The journal employs rigorous double-blind review to ensure quality publications. Authors receive comment through feedforward communication approach. It is the prime objective of the reviewers to help authors improve the quality of the papers. As the journal promotes internationalization and collaboration, the multi-dimensional perspectives of the author and reviewers add high value to the research article. Moreover, the journal has solid support system for copyediting and formatting. The journal ensures that the research articles are within the standards of international publication.
